VHF Channel 6 is used exclusively for what kind of communications?

A Inter-vessel safety and search and rescue
B Working with helicopters
C Radio checks and time checks
D Radio direction finding
AI Explanation

The correct answer is A) Inter-vessel safety and search and rescue. VHF Channel 6 is designated for safety communications between vessels. This includes exchanging information related to the safety of navigation, coordinating search and rescue operations, and other critical communications between ships. It is not used for routine radio checks, direction finding, or working with helicopters, which is why options B, C, and D are incorrect.
